Continuing the Alabama Board of Examiners in Counseling

This law keeps the Alabama Board of Examiners in Counseling running until October 1, 2028.

What This Bill Does

  • Keeps the Alabama Board of Examiners in Counseling active and working until October 1, 2028.

Who It Names or Affects

  • The Alabama Board of Examiners in Counseling
  • People who work with or are regulated by the board

Terms To Know

Sunset Law
A law that sets a time limit for government agencies to prove their usefulness before they can be renewed.
Alabama Board of Examiners in Counseling
An agency that oversees and regulates counseling professionals in Alabama.

Limits and Unknowns

  • The law only continues the board's existence until October 1, 2028.
  • It does not change how the board operates or its responsibilities.

Enrolled, An Act,
Relating to the Alabama Sunset Law; to continue the
existence and functioning of the Alabama Board of Examiners in
Counseling until October 1, 2028.
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F ALABAMA:
Section 1. Pursuant to the Alabama Sunset Law, the
Sunset Committee recommends the continuance of the Alabama
Board of Examiners in Counseling until October 1, 2028.
Section 2. The existence and functioning of the Alabama
Board of Examiners in Counseling, created and functioning
pursuant to Sections 34-8A-1 to 34-8A-24, inclusive, Code of
Alabama 1975, is continued until October 1, 2028, and those
code sections are expressly preserved.
Section 3. The Legislature concurs in the
recommendations of the Sunset Committee as provided in
Sections 1 and 2.
Section 4. This act shall become effective June 1,
2026.
